Salary of Electrical Engineering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$86,613 Bachelor's Median Salary

Electrical Engineering students who finish a bachelor’s at NAU go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$86,613 a year. This is above $58,050, the median for all majors at NAU.

Student Debt of Electrical Engineering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$20,500 Bachelor's Median Debt

Earning a bachelor’s degree at NAU, electrical engineering students accumulate a median of $20,500 in student loans. This is below $21,833, the typical median for all majors at NAU.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 81% of electrical engineering bachelor’s degrees went to men and 19% went to women.

NAU gender breakdown of Electrical Engineering Bachelor's degree grads The majority of electrical engineering bachelor’s degree graduates at NAU are White. Approximately 44% of graduates fell into this category.
